The Digital Test AdministrationSpecialistis responsible forthe execution of key operational functions that support digital test administration, with a growing focus on administrations delivered through the Surpass platform. These functions include registration, validation, and oversightof the administration process, as well as critical post-administration activities. This role ensures the successful delivery of secure, standardized testing experiences byleveragingdigital tools, coordinating stakeholders, and supporting the transition and scaling of digital testing solutions across Puerto Rico and Latin America.

About the Team

The Test Administration&Registration(TRA) team is part of the Operations Division that executes and supports value chain processes core to the successful delivery of College Board testadministration. We strive to ensure all students and testing staff are provided with a flawless testing experience—whether paper-based or digital—and continually assess and remove blockers that may affect this goal. As part of our evolution, we are actively supporting the transition to digital testing ecosystems, including platforms such as Surpass, ensuring readiness across test centers, staff, and systems. We focus on continuous improvement, onboarding and management of testing sites, and equipping coordinators with the tools and knowledge needed to administer assessments with excellence. We believe in delivering high-quality work within a collaborative team environment built on trust, diversity of thought, and innovation.

About the opportunity

TheDigitalTest Administration & Registration Specialist is a team player responsible for planning and coordinating the administration of standardized tests for Puerto Rico and Latin America, with increasing emphasis on digital test delivery through Surpass. This includes managing registrations, schedules, validation processes, preparing administrative and digital materials, supporting platform readiness, and ensuring that testing conditions—both physical and digital—are conducive to fairness, security, and validity. The role requires close collaboration with internal teams and external partners to ensure compliance with policies, successful adoption of digital tools, and seamless execution of test administrations.

In this role, you will:

Task Management and Strategy: (40%)

  • Manage and track value chain processes for test administrations across Puerto Rico and Latin America, including digital administrations via Surpass.

  • Develop,maintain, and execute the annual calendar of test delivery activities.

  • Support test setup, configuration, and readiness within the Surpass platform, including candidate registration workflows and test session preparation.

  • Identifyand secure test locations, equipment, and digital infrastructure (devices, connectivity, system readiness) to support both paper and digital administrations.

  • Develop, review, andmaintainupdated administrative documentation, including digital testing guidelines and platform instructions.

  • Communicate and support internal teams and external institutions to ensure compliance with test administration regulations and digital protocols.

  • Coordinate with test-takers, proctors, and staff to ensure adherence to both in-person and digital administration procedures.

  • Identifyand resolve operational and technical issues that may arise during test administration.

Oversight and Quality: (40%)

  • Monitor and ensure completion of tasks asestablishedin the test administration calendar.

  • Maintainaccuraterecords and data related to test administrations.

  • Ensure that all test administration procedures are followedcorrectlyand that test materials are prepared and distributed accurately.

  • Process invoices related to test administration.

  • Coordinate students’accommodationsrequests, once approved, with the test centers.

  • Prepare andassistthe unit team with periodic reports.

  • Perform the test administration simulations or exercises asneededand manage results.

About The College Board

College Board is a not-for-profit organization that clears a path for all students to own their future through the Advanced Placement Program, the SAT, Official SAT Practice on Khan Academy, BigFuture, and more. For more information, go to collegeboard.org.
